We're Here to Help
Let's Start a Conversation
Have questions about our services or need a custom order? Our dedicated support team is available 24/7 to assist you.
Get In Touch
Send Us A Message
Prefer to write to us directly? Fill out the form below, and our team will get back to you within 24 hours. Whether you need a custom package for reviews or have a question about account verification, we are here to clarify everything.
Office Location
123 Digital Ave, Tech City, USA
Working Hours
Mon - Sun: 24 Hours / 7 Days